> Im having this speed: > 17000KB/s from SATA to tape You must have a fast tape drive (LTO2+, SDLT ...) or very highly compressible data.
> 35000KB/s from SATA(data) to SATA(data-stored by bacula) > Unless you have a raid (0, 5, 6, 10, 50 ...) 35MB/s is very good. > Is this normal? or im doing some wrong? > These numbers look good however there really can not be any discussion of normal without discussing your hardware, your data, the bacula database, you network speed, compression and what type of backup you do.
